English Translation

Abu Hurayrah رضي الله عنه reported that the Messenger of Allah ﷺ said: 'Whoever gives in charity the equivalent of a date from lawful earnings — and Allah does not accept anything except what is lawful — the Most Merciful takes it in His Right Hand and nurtures it for its owner, just as one of you nurtures his foal, until it becomes like a mountain.'

Reference: Musnad Ahmad, Book 18, Hadith 593
